Surya Son of Krishnan " (originally titled Vaaranam Aayiram ) is a landmark 2008 semi-autobiographical film directed by Gautham Vasudev Menon that has attained cult status for its emotional depth and realistic portrayal of a father-son relationship. Core Premise and Themes
